Temperature matters: what counts as effective disinfection

Disinfection efficacy depends on reaching sustained high temperatures throughout the cycle. most dishwasher manuals describe sanitize options that reach at least 60°C (140°F) or higher for a period of time. In practice, cycles labeled as sanitize or high-heat should aspirationally exceed this threshold, with water temperature monitored by the machine. The Dishwasher Tips analysis, 2026, notes that temperature alone is not the sole determinant; cycle duration, water coverage, and soil load all influence outcomes. For households, selecting a dedicated sanitize cycle and ensuring the dishwasher is in good working order are practical steps toward reducing Salmonella risk on clean dishes.

How soil, loading, and food residue affect outcomes

A dish surface with baked-on sauce or dried milk can shield bacteria from hot water and detergents. Proper pre-rinsing or scraping reduces this burden and helps the dishwasher reach sanitizing temperatures more effectively. Avoid overcrowding; water needs unimpeded access to all surfaces. Plastics and warped items can trap moisture or heat poorly, reducing sanitization potential. The goal is consistent water contact and even distribution so that hot water and detergent reach every item, especially in the corners and racks where residue tends to accumulate.

How to verify your dishwasher’s sanitizing performance

If you want to gauge sanitizing performance, start with the basics: verify that the machine is delivering hot water consistently by checking the final rinse temperature with a kitchen thermometer when safe to do so. Review your manual to understand the sanitize cycle's duration and temperature profile. Some households may use external thermometers temporarily to confirm, while others rely on the machine’s diagnostic indicators. Regular maintenance, including cleaning filters and checking spray arms, improves overall cleaning and disinfection efficiency.

What cycle temperatures are required to kill Salmonella?

Most sanitize cycles aim for about 60°C (140°F) or higher for sustained periods. Check your appliance’s documentation to confirm the exact temperature profile and cycle duration.

Look for the sanitize setting; ensure your machine actually reaches the high-heat cycle.

Is the heated-dry setting necessary for disinfection?

Heated dry contributes to drying and may aid in reducing surface moisture, but disinfection primarily comes from hot wash water and the sanitize cycle. Rely on the sanitize option for best results.

Heated dry helps with drying, but the main disinfecting power comes from hot washing.

Can a dishwasher kill Salmonella on non-dish items like cutting boards?

Dishwashers are designed for dishware. Some non-porous items can be sanitized if they fit and tolerate dishwashing conditions, but always follow manufacturer guidance for non-dish items and separate food-contact surfaces.

Only if the item is dishwasher-safe and the cycle is appropriate.

Can I rely on a standard wash to disinfect after handling raw poultry?

A standard wash without sanitize settings may not reliably kill Salmonella. Use a sanitize/high-heat cycle and thoroughly rinse, then practice safe handling and storage of raw poultry.

Use the sanitize cycle and handle raw poultry safely.
